SDSU does not offer an online option for its general public health master’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the SDSU Online Learning page.
Women made up around 77.3% of the general public health students who took home a master’s degree in 2019-2020. This is in the same ballpark of the nationwide number of 77.0%.
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 53.4% of the general public health master’s degrees at SDSU in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 43%.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 21 |
Black or African American | 7 |
Hispanic or Latino | 13 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 1 |
White | 38 |
International Students | 2 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 6 |
